Israel Adesanya Closes Pereira Chapter, Signals Return Built on Freedom Over Titles

The former middleweight champion, unbooked since a February TKO loss, now tells fans he is “retired.”

Overview

  • Speaking at a Bangtao Muay Thai Q&A, Adesanya declared his long rivalry with Alex Pereira finished and said he hopes Pereira never loses again and retires undefeated.
  • He said he tells people he is “retired” until a fight poster appears, emphasizing that any comeback will prioritize creativity and risk over chasing the middleweight belt.
  • Adesanya acknowledged speculation that Pereira could face Jon Jones at a prospective White House event and voiced support for his former foe’s light heavyweight run.
  • The 36-year-old is on a three-fight skid, including a February 2025 TKO loss to Nassourdine Imavov in Saudi Arabia, and he has no opponent or return date confirmed.
  • He also revisited his kickboxing past, alleging Glory “screwed” him out of a world title, while noting the promotion still helped elevate his early career.
